"I like McCree's Hot Potato": an Overwatch Workshop conversation with Blizzard

“I like McCree’s Hot Potato.”

Well yes, don’t we all, but what I find striking about the sentiment is it comes from Blizzard, from an Overwatch developer and a very senior one at that – lead gameplay developer Keith Miron. And it’s about a game mode in Overwatch that Blizzard didn’t make.

McCree’s Hot Potato is very simple. It changes Overwatch so a small group of McCrees play against each other, passing a burning buck. If you’re the hot potato, you’re on fire and your health burns away, so you need to pass it on by shooting or hitting someone before you die. The last one standing wins.

Miron also likes another mode based on a web game called Agar.io, where you’re a blob and loads of other people are too, and you need to grow big enough to eat them. In Overwatch, you’re not a blob, you’re blobby Roadhog, and every time you hook another player or grab a power-up, the sphere around you grows. But the aim is the same: grow so big you consume everyone around you.
